  2. Camp Seymour -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Camp_Seymour

    Camp Seymour is a YMCA camping facility located in Washington state. It is considered a branch of the YMCA of Pierce and Kitsap Counties and has been in operation since 1907. [ 1 ] As of 2019, it frequently sold out and a sister camp at Lake Helena was established. [ 2 ]

  7. Metro Parks Tacoma -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Metro_Parks_Tacoma

    Metro Parks Tacoma owns and operates parks and recreation facilities in the city of Tacoma as well as the unincorporated areas of Browns Point and Dash Point. Metro Parks Tacoma is overseen by a board of five commissioners, all elected by voters city-wide and each serving staggered six-year terms.

  9. Charles Wright Academy -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Charles_Wright_Academy

    Charles Wright Academy is a coed private college preparatory school in University Place, Washington, offering Preschool to Grade 12. [1]CWA is a member of the National Association of Independent Schools (NAIS) and the Northwest Association of Independent Schools (NWAIS).
